DEMOCRATIC REPUBLIC OF TIMOR-LESTE
GOVERNMENT DECREE - LAW
17/2008
ORGANIC LAW OF THE MINISTRY OF TOURISM, TRADE AND INDUSTRY
The Programme of IV Constitutional Government provides for a policy of development of tourism activities, business and industry, as a mechanism of capital importance in reducing the poverty and the fight against unemployment, contributing positively to social and political stability of the country.
The Decree-Law No. 7/2007 of 5 September 2007 laying down the organizational structure of IV constitutional Government of Democratic Republic of Timor-Leste determines, in its Section 37, in formulating or amending their Ministries Organic Laws. This Decree-Law establishes the structure of organs and services that comprise the Ministry of tourism, Trade and Industry, giving them the skills necessary for the prosecution of the Government policies for these areas, in line with the provisions of Section 29 of that law.
Therefore ,
The Government decrees, pursuant to paragraph 3 of Section 115 of the Constitution of the Republic to act as law, the following:
Chapter I
Nature and Assignments
Section 1
Nature
The Ministry of tourism, Trade and Industry, hereinafter MTCI, is the central organ of Government whose mission is to develop, regulate, run, coordinate and evaluate the policy defined and approved by the Council of Ministers, to the fields of tourism, Trade and industry.
Section 2
Assignments
In pursuit of its mission, are tasks of MTCI:
a) Propose policies and draw up the draft rules and regulations necessary to their areas of responsibility;
b) Design, execute and evaluate trade policy;
c) Contribute to boost commercial economic activity, including the internal and international competitiveness;
d) Analyze the business activity and to propose relevant measures and public policies for business development and international trade;
e) Support the activities of economic operators of the commercial and industrial sectors, promoting the necessary ways for valid solutions in order to make it simple and swift to administrative proceedings, limiting it to the indispensable.
f) Advising on previous requested information for the establishment of trading companies as well as to acquire the status of investor;
g) Evaluate and give licence for projects of installations and operation of industrial, commercial and touristic resorts;
h) Support commercial activities, including building markets, aiming at the enhancement of the conditions thereof;
i) Inspect and monitor the economic activities of their guardianship, pursuant to law; Conceive, implement and evaluate policies in the industrial sector;
j) Maintain and administer information and documentation centre on companies and industrial activities;
k) Propose the revocation or suspension of the licence of industrial activities performance , when appropriate;
l) Propose the qualification and classification of industrial projects, in particular, the economic activities in general;
m) Organize and administer the register of industrial property;
n) Promote the internal rules and international standardisation, metrology and quality control, measurement standards of physical units and magnitude;
o) Design, implement and evaluate national tourism policy, including the aspects of leisure, fun and ecotourism;
p) Prepare the annual plan of activities for the development of tourism with its estimated costs;
q) Implement and enforce the legislation concerning installation, licensing, sorting and checking the status of operation of tourist facilities;
r) Establish mechanisms for collaboration with other governamental departments and agencies on related areas, in particular the competent services planners and physical development of the territory to promote strategic areas of national tourism development;
s) Cooperate with the competent bodies and public institutes, national and international, for Timor-Leste promotion and disclosure , with investors and tour operators;
t) Regulating the organized association of the activities and professions of the industrial, commercial and touristic sectors ,rationally and integrated , preferably under a single representative structure.
u) Regulating and supervising the industrial, commercial and touristic activities , especially, those of conditioned access, and or reserved , liable to licencing or public concession in collaboration with related entities and policies defined by the government;
v) Analyze and propose to the Council of Ministers the formation of international partnerships activities subject by MTCI, depending on the cost-benefits for the Country.
w) Manage the budget, procurement and internal finance, under the law.
Chapter II
Supervision and Oversight
Section 3
Supervision and Oversight
The MTCI is superiorly tutored by the Minister, that represents and shall be accountable to the Prime Minister.
Chapter III
Organic Structure
Section 4
General Structure
1. The MTCI pursues its mission through integrated services in the direct administration of the State bodies involved in indirect administration and territorial delegations advisory bodies.
2. By reasoned order of the Minister, can be created territorial delegations of tourism services, Commerce and industry, in furtherance of deconcentration measures or administrative and financial decentralization, under the law.
Section 5
Services of direct administration of the State:
1) Integrate direct administration of the State, under the MTCI, the following core services:
a) Directorate-General;
b) Inspection and Internal Audit;
c) National Tourism Directorate;
d) National Directorate of Domestic Trade;
e) National Directorate of Foreign Trade;
f) National Directorate of Industry
g) National Directorate of Administration and Finance;
h) National Directorate of Research and Development
2) With technical and administrative autonomy, but under the tutelage of functional and integrate financial oversight, Minister of MTCI , still continue the structure and tasks of the following bodies:
a) Economic and Food Inspection.
b) General Inspectorate of games
Section 6
Food and Economic Inspection and General Inspection of Games by proposal of the Minister of Tourism, Trade and Industry, the Council of Ministers may approve the conversion of such bodies, giving them financial autonomy and assets, with the objective of meeting the operational requirements of the Ministry where indirect administration mode is best suited to serve the public interest.
